Neonatal chest x-ray (left sided marker confirmed) demonstrates dextrocardia and complete situs inversus. This would include position of the IVC and the aorta given the positions of the umbilical lines. The lungs show improved aeration but persistent prominence of the perihilar interstitium. No air leak is noted.
Eventually found to be Kartagener syndrome.
